Repairing window locks with UPVC

uPVC is a popular choice for renovations and new homes. They offer a number of benefits, including their durability, ease of maintenance and energy efficiency. These windows are BPAand phthalate-free, making them safe for children. They are also rustproof and do not require varnishing or painting. They aren't susceptible to warping or rotting and are easy to maintain. However, despite their strength and ease of maintenance, sometimes your uPVC windows may develop issues that require professional attention. These problems may include windows that are draughty or a broken handle or a damaged lock.

uPVC window and door locks could become damaged over the years due to wear and tear or accidental damage. This makes them less effective and vulnerable to break-ins. A gap between the sash's frame and the frame may be the cause of your uPVC windows not closing properly. This can lead to drafts, but it could also cause damp and water damage. To test this, you can try putting a piece of paper between the frame and the sash to see if it can be closed.

To repair this, you'll need to break the seal around the frame and sash. You will then need to remove the locking mechanism from its position within the frame. This will require the assistance of a tool such as a flat screwdriver and a torch to get the gearbox. After you have removed the gearbox, you'll need to replace it with a brand new one of the same type and size.

UPVC window frame repair

If your uPVC windows are damaged, have cracks or holes, or even damaged window seals it is important to repair them immediately. These issues can cause the glass to fog, and can also lead to water leaks. In addition, the damage to the frames can decrease the insulation value of your home and cause more expensive energy bills. The majority of these issues can be easily addressed by an expert or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repair is more cost-effective than replacing the entire window, but there are situations where it's more beneficial to replace the entire window. This is particularly true if the frame is damaged beyond repair. The cost of a UPVC replacement window is affected by a variety of factors, such as the type of material used and the amount of labor involved. A full replacement can cost between $100 and $1000 per window. The cost will vary based on the severity of damage and whether or whether the window needs to be replaced.
